Grammar list

てばかり

(Te bakari)

Expresses that someone spends all their time doing one thing, often with a critical tone.

Connection rules

  • Verb (te-form) + ばかり

Examples

1.
息子むすこ毎日まいにちあそんでばかりで全然ぜんぜん勉強べんきょうしません。

Musuko ha mainichi ason de bakari de zenzen benkyou shi mase n.

My son does nothing but play every day and doesn't study at all.

Worried mother talking

2.
おとうとてばかりいて、どこにもかけません。

Otouto ha ne te bakari i te, doko ni mo dekake mase n.

My younger brother spends all his time sleeping and doesn't go out anywhere.
